Job Summary

We are seeking for an Interior Designer to assess our property site conditions and create functional layouts to optimise space usage, while developing detailed design plans, mood boards, and visual representations. In this role, your responsibilities also include selecting materials, collaborating with suppliers and contractors, and overseeing the installation process to ensure designs are executed to high-quality standards.

Job Responsibilities

  • ⁠Visit site to assess its layout, dimensions, and existing conditions. Take measurements and note architectural features, structural limitations, and potential design opportunities.
  • Design functional layouts that optimise the space usage, ensuring the arrangement of furniture, fixtures, and circulation adheres to any spatial constraints.
  • Develop mood/ sample boards and colour palettes to convey desired aesthetic to client/mall.
  • Produce detailed drawings of floor plans, elevations, and sections.
  • Generate visual representations with lighting to visualize the final design.
  • Select and specify materials, finishes, and furnishings. Have a good understanding of material termination details.
  • Collaborate and liaise with suppliers and contractors to ensure the design is executed according to plans and specifications.
  • Source and propose furniture, fixtures, equipment (FF & E), and other design elements. Ensure that all items are ordered, delivered, and installed as planned.
  • Oversee the installation process to ensure that all design elements are installed correctly and meet quality standards from time to time.

Job Requirements

  • At least Diploma in interior design with adequate working experience is acceptable.
  • Preferably 3 - 5 years of interior designing experience.
  • Proficiency in design software such as AutoCAD, SketchUp (3Ds Max is a plus) and Adobe Creative Suite especially Photoshop and Illustrator.
  • Good understanding of materials, finishes, furniture and details.
  • Basic knowledge of construction and carpentry work.
  • Good eye for detail.
  • Experience in project management, tender processes and costing will be an added advantage.
